General Adult Psychiatry<br />
Dr Darren Mackintosh<br />
Cornwall Partnership NHS Foundation Trust<br />
Trengweath, Penryn Street, Redruth, Cornwall TR15 2SP<br />
JOB DESCRIPTION: The Specialty Trainee would undertake an apprenticeship role, learning psychiatry through<br />
joining both an inpatient and community team and taking a responsible clinical role. They will provide<br />
supervised medical input to a comprehensive mental health service for adults of working age registered with<br />
GP Surgeries in Camborne, North Kerrier, and in the <strong>South</strong> Kerrier region. The trainee will be expected to<br />
conduct ward rounds, complete new assessments and joint visits with community colleagues.<br />
The acute inpatient beds are based on Bay Unit at Longreach House, Redruth where there are 32 acute beds<br />
shared between eight consultant psychiatrists. Bay Unit is divided into two wards; Perran and Carbis Wards,<br />
generally gender specific. The wards are served by an FY2 trainee attached to the team, who also assesses<br />
community patients in the outpatient clinic.<br />
The CMHT is spilt between Trengweath, serving the Camborne population, and Helston, serving <strong>South</strong> Kerrier;<br />
though joint meetings are held weekly in Helston for referral allocation and discussion of clinical issues.<br />
Outpatient Clinics are held at both Trengweath, in Redruth, and at the Community Mental Health Team base in<br />
Helston.<br />
The supervising consultant also provides medical cover to the Home Treatment Team, Assertive Outreach<br />
Team, the Eating Disorders Team, and some community forensic patients. Intensive care, rehabilitation and<br />
low secure beds for the whole of the county are located at Bodmin with separate medical cover; though the<br />
supervising consultant is called on to provide cover when colleagues are away. Close liaison with the Early<br />
intervention team is required, as the catchment area consultant provides inpatient care for that team’s<br />
patients when required.<br />
Teaching opportunities are available in the form of medical students attached to the inpatient unit. Teaching<br />
at the academic meetings for junior doctors will also be encouraged. The Audit department is located close to<br />
the trainee’s office, facilitating audit projects if desired.<br />
The trainee will be provided with at least one hour direct supervision per week. The trainee’s office is located<br />
immediately adjacent to the trainer so regular informal discussions should also be possible.<br />
